Just for anyone going through this, the inner wheel seal has the lips and outer does not. In the video they were installed in incorrect locations.

Never remove the abs sensor on any car with a few yrs age on it, too big a risk because the majority snap. Best to just unplug the sensor connector up on the harness (shop life, live and learn)
